Default DC Sports Muffler Update see page 3

Ok I have a Big Gripe about DC Sports Mufflers ... Driving to work this morning I decided to stop by frys market place to get a Starbucks Frappuccino as I pull in the drive way off the street I hear something metal bouncing around look in my mirror and see my exahust tip bounching in the parking lot.....

After picking the tip up I was looking at the weld and it seems that there was hardly any penatration from the weld. I have heard of others here on Scion Life have their tip fall off....
